Michigan League is a student life building at the University of Michigan in Ann Arbor, Michigan. It is located at 911 N. UNIVERSITY AVE, Ann Arbor, MI 48109, on the University of Michigan's Central campus. The building has 5 floors. The building code is LEAG, used in class schedules and room assignments. The building features ramp access. It houses Ballroom, Conference Room 2 1, Conference Room 4 1, Conference Room 6 1 and 28 more. Visit the official website for current hours and information. From the Diag, Michigan League is approximately 3 minutes walking north.

History
- Year Built: 1929 (Source: Bentley Historical Library)
- Architect: Pond & Pond, Martin & Lloyd
- Style: Collegiate Gothic
- Named for: Women's counterpart to the Michigan Union
- Notable: Pewabic tile floors, oak-paneled walls, stained glass; houses Lydia Mendelssohn Theatre
- Primary use: Student union, event spaces, dining, theater
Accessibility
- Ramp Access: Use building's south entrance (facing N. University Ave. and the circle driveway)
